利用PC鍵盤和CRT顯示器設(shè)計一個電子琴,首先在CRT顯示器上模擬出琴鍵的畫面,然后要求在不同的情況下按下鍵盤上“1~7”中任意數(shù)字鍵,可彈奏出與之相應(yīng)的音調(diào),且在模擬鍵盤上標示出對應(yīng)的那個鍵來。 設(shè)計應(yīng)完成以下功能: (1)按“1~7”中的任一數(shù)字鍵,則發(fā)出對應(yīng)的中音. (2)若同時按下“高音鍵”和“1~7”中的任一數(shù)字鍵,則發(fā)出對應(yīng)的高音。 (3)若同時按下“低音鍵”和“1~7”中的任一數(shù)字鍵,則發(fā)出對應(yīng)的低音。 (4)發(fā)聲的節(jié)拍根據(jù)按鍵的長短決定。 (5)根據(jù)鍵盤按下的鍵讓對應(yīng)的琴鍵發(fā)生變化。 (6)可以實現(xiàn)兩音調(diào)的選擇。 (7)可以預先存放5首曲子,按下不同的按鍵則對演奏出不同的曲子。 (8)按下“結(jié)束鍵”,程序運行結(jié)束,返回到DOS狀態(tài)
資源簡介:利用PC鍵盤和CRT顯示器設(shè)計一個電子琴,首先在CRT顯示器上模擬出琴鍵的畫面,然后要求在不同的情況下按下鍵盤上“1~7”中任意數(shù)字鍵,可彈奏出與之相應(yīng)的音調(diào),且在模擬鍵盤上標示出對應(yīng)的那個鍵來。 設(shè)計應(yīng)完成以下功能: (1)按“1~7”中的任一數(shù)字鍵,...
上傳時間: 2016-03-17
上傳用戶:talenthn
資源簡介:用51單片機開發(fā)的PC鍵盤接口程序,包括源程序,包括<PS2 PC鍵盤編程參考資料 .doc>和<單片機系統(tǒng)與標準PC鍵盤的接口模塊設(shè)計.doc>
上傳時間: 2016-01-13
上傳用戶:璇珠官人
資源簡介:基于8279的鍵盤和顯示電路設(shè)計
上傳時間: 2013-11-03
上傳用戶:貓愛薛定諤
資源簡介:用java編寫的一個基于GUI的算術(shù)四則運算(加、減、乘、除)的計算器。 1.綜合使用swing包的容器類和組件類設(shè)計一個合理的界面; 2.只能對整型數(shù)據(jù)進行處理; 3. 只能完成加、減、乘、除四項基本功能; 4.參照Windows附件中的計算器的外觀和功能
上傳時間: 2014-01-03
上傳用戶:wpt
資源簡介:開發(fā)環(huán)境為ICC。通過串口顯示PC鍵盤的ASCII碼的一個小程序。
上傳時間: 2015-06-17
上傳用戶:hanli8870
資源簡介:基礎(chǔ)知識;利用自己所學的知識設(shè)計一個可以實現(xiàn)匿名的網(wǎng)絡(luò)系統(tǒng),通過此系統(tǒng)發(fā)郵件可以不讓對方知道你的IP地址,從而保證了系統(tǒng)的安全性!
上傳時間: 2015-07-18
上傳用戶:manlian
資源簡介:映射和重建 產(chǎn)生測試圖像并顯示 另一程序 利用radon函數(shù)和iradon函數(shù)構(gòu)造一個簡單圖像的投影并重建圖像
上傳時間: 2015-12-16
上傳用戶:Ants
資源簡介:對于給頂?shù)膫}庫局,以及倉庫管理員在倉庫中的位置和箱子的開始位置和目標位置,設(shè)計一個解推箱子問題的分支限界法,計算出倉庫管理員將箱子從開始位置推到目標位置所需的最少推動次數(shù).
上傳時間: 2014-01-10
上傳用戶:zm7516678
資源簡介:利用網(wǎng)卡和單片機改裝的一個網(wǎng)卡,有電路和程序。
上傳時間: 2016-07-12
上傳用戶:zhouli
資源簡介:利用了struts和bibernate實現(xiàn)的一個bbs demo
上傳時間: 2013-12-23
上傳用戶:894898248
資源簡介::介紹非接觸能量傳輸系統(tǒng)的控制電路硬件設(shè)計。利用ARM9芯片和電源技術(shù)設(shè)計出CPT系統(tǒng)的嵌入式控制系統(tǒng)。實驗表明,該控制電路能夠達到非接觸能量傳輸系統(tǒng)的控制要求。
上傳時間: 2013-12-31
上傳用戶:lxm
資源簡介:利用Card類和循環(huán)語句編寫一個撲克牌游戲
上傳時間: 2013-12-29
上傳用戶:duoshen1989
資源簡介:使用Meadow處理觸摸鍵盤和SPI顯示器源碼使用Meadow處理觸摸鍵盤和SPI顯示器源碼
上傳時間: 2022-01-25
上傳用戶:qdxqdxqdxqdx
資源簡介:用c++程序,基于8255和8253實現(xiàn)的一個電子琴程序
上傳時間: 2015-10-04
上傳用戶:aig85
資源簡介:用單片機 4v4鍵盤和音頻放大模塊制作電子琴
上傳時間: 2014-06-13
上傳用戶:aappkkee
資源簡介:問題描述:設(shè)計一個程序?qū)崿F(xiàn)兩個任意長的整數(shù)的求和運算。 基本要求:利用雙向循環(huán)鏈表,設(shè)計一個實現(xiàn)任意長的整數(shù)進行加法運算的演示程序。要求輸入和輸出每四位一組,組間用逗號隔開。如:1,0000,0000,0000,0000。
上傳時間: 2013-12-12
上傳用戶:731140412
資源簡介:硬件中斷時鐘設(shè)計 利用PC系列微機現(xiàn)有的硬件和軟件資源,編寫程序,使在顯示器屏幕上顯示XX(時):XX(分):XX(秒),并且每秒鐘更新一次顯示。 輸入一個回車開始計時。
上傳時間: 2016-08-30
上傳用戶:邶刖
資源簡介:【問題描述】 設(shè)計一個利用哈夫曼算法的編碼和譯碼系統(tǒng),重復地顯示并處理以下項目,直到選擇退出為止。 【基本要求】 (1)初始化:鍵盤輸入字符集大小n、n個字符和n個權(quán)值,建立哈夫曼樹; (2)編碼:利用建好的哈夫曼樹生成哈夫曼編碼; (3...
上傳時間: 2017-03-07
上傳用戶:qwe1234
資源簡介:在PC機上 利用dos 環(huán)境 開發(fā)一個電子琴和電子鐘的界面,其中有時間顯示界面以及鍵盤界面,可以演奏你自己的音樂。
上傳時間: 2013-12-24
上傳用戶:CHINA526
資源簡介:基于PC機的電子琴設(shè)計 一、實驗?zāi)康模保莆绽胮c機揚聲器發(fā)出聲音的方法。2.學習利用系統(tǒng)功能調(diào)用從鍵盤上讀取字符的方法。 二、實驗內(nèi)容與要求利用PC機和揚聲器實現(xiàn)簡易電子琴的功能。?1.基本要求(1)電子琴功能,編寫程序,程序運行時使pc機成為一...
上傳時間: 2013-10-16
上傳用戶:xlcky
資源簡介:乒乓球游戲機實驗報告實驗人: 大火虎設(shè)計課題: 用VHDL設(shè)計一個乒乓球游戲機,用開關(guān)來摸擬球手及裁判,用LED來模擬乒乓球,采用每局十一球賽制,比分由七段顯示器顯示. 設(shè)計思路: 采用按功能分塊,將整個電路分成若干子程序,利用不同的子程序來實現(xiàn)記分,顯示,...
上傳時間: 2015-08-25
上傳用戶:gtzj
資源簡介:設(shè)計一個單片機控制的秒表系統(tǒng)。利用單片機的定時器/計數(shù)器定時和記數(shù)的原理,結(jié)合顯示電路、LED數(shù)碼管以及按鍵來設(shè)計計時器。將軟、硬件有機地結(jié)合起來,使得系統(tǒng)能夠正確地進行加、減(倒)計時,數(shù)碼管能夠正確地顯示時間。
上傳時間: 2016-07-02
上傳用戶:15736969615
資源簡介:利用BIOS和DOS的中斷來設(shè)計一個計算器,要求在屏幕上顯示一個主菜單,提示用戶輸入相應(yīng)的數(shù)字鍵,分別執(zhí)行加、減、乘、除四種計算功能和結(jié)束程序的功能。
上傳時間: 2016-12-15
上傳用戶:q123321
資源簡介:我在08年11月利用flex3.0 mxml和as3.0設(shè)計的一個3D相冊,用到trans matrix和一些控件 6個源碼文件 具體效果請看 http://www.macs.hw.ac.uk/~yw173/3DPROJECT/album2/bin-debug/album2main.swf dec 30 2008 英國愛丁堡
上傳時間: 2017-02-01
上傳用戶:it男一枚
資源簡介:利用計數(shù)器和分頻器設(shè)計一個實時的時鐘。一共需要1個模24計數(shù)器、2個模6計數(shù)器、2個模10計數(shù)器、一個生成1Hz的分頻器和6個數(shù)碼管解碼器。最終用HEX5~HEX4顯示小時(0~23),用HEX3~HEX2顯示分鐘(0~59),用HEX1~HEX0顯示秒鐘(0~59)。
上傳時間: 2014-12-20
上傳用戶:dbs012280
資源簡介:設(shè)計一個圖形用戶界面,利用下表的數(shù)據(jù),設(shè)計窗體界面來演示數(shù)據(jù)插值,在窗體界面上分別演示線性插值和三樣條插值在每分鐘內(nèi)每隔的秒數(shù),鋼軌每隔米不同長度處.這兩個參數(shù)由用戶輸入,繪制改變插方法,和改變參數(shù)后的圖形輸出.并用”選項”菜單控制:網(wǎng)格開關(guān),圖例開...
上傳時間: 2017-06-25
上傳用戶:愛死愛死
資源簡介:利用FPGA 設(shè)計一個類似點陣LCD 顯示的VGA 顯示控制器,可實現(xiàn)文字及簡單的圖表顯示。工作時只需將要顯示內(nèi)容轉(zhuǎn)換成對應(yīng)字模送入FPGA,即可實現(xiàn)相應(yīng)內(nèi)容的顯示。關(guān)鍵詞:FPGA;VGA;顯示控制 隨著數(shù)字圖像處理的應(yīng)用領(lǐng)域的不斷擴大,其實時處理技術(shù)成為研究的...
上傳時間: 2013-10-26
上傳用戶:lgd57115700
資源簡介:利用FPGA 設(shè)計一個類似點陣LCD 顯示的VGA 顯示控制器,可實現(xiàn)文字及簡單的圖表顯示。工作時只需將要顯示內(nèi)容轉(zhuǎn)換成對應(yīng)字模送入FPGA,即可實現(xiàn)相應(yīng)內(nèi)容的顯示。關(guān)鍵詞:FPGA;VGA;顯示控制 隨著數(shù)字圖像處理的應(yīng)用領(lǐng)域的不斷擴大,其實時處理技術(shù)成為研究的...
上傳時間: 2013-11-16
上傳用戶:410805624
資源簡介:設(shè)計一個鍵盤程序,其行線(8條)連接在P0口上,列線(8條)連接在P2口上,這個鍵盤的編碼為0到63,同時設(shè)計一個二位的數(shù)碼管顯示器,其段選信號由P1.0到P1.6來控制完成,位選信號由P1.7、P3.2來完成。最后大家把按鍵的編碼顯示在數(shù)碼管顯示器上。
上傳時間: 2016-06-24
上傳用戶:731140412
資源簡介:本電子計價稱的設(shè)計主要包括橋式應(yīng)變電路、前置放大電路、AD轉(zhuǎn)換電路、微處理器、報警器、鍵盤和液晶顯示。其中橋式應(yīng)變電路主要完成壓力信號的測量,把物體的重量轉(zhuǎn)換成電壓信號,獲得初步的信號,然后把這個信號送給后面的前置放大電路,由放大電路把這個微...
上傳時間: 2016-07-02
上傳用戶:lwwhust